
在线教育搭建方案的云服务器配置怎么选择
说实话,当我第一次帮朋友规划他的在线教育平台时,我对"云服务器配置"这四个字完全是一头雾水。那时候我觉得,不就是租个服务器嘛,能有多复杂?结果真正上手才发现,这里面的水真的很深。
在线教育这个场景,跟普通的网站或者App有着本质的区别。它不是简简单单让人看看文字图片就完事了,而是需要把老师的声音、表情、课件实时传递给几十甚至几百个学生。这里面涉及到的技术复杂度,远超一般人的想象。今天我就用大白话的方式,跟大家聊聊在线教育的云服务器到底该怎么选才能不踩坑。
在线教育对技术的要求,跟你想的真的不一样
很多人一开始可能会觉得,在线教育嘛,不就是把视频直播的技术搬过来用吗?我可以负责任地告诉你,这种想法会让你在第一步就栽跟头。
教育场景有一个非常独特的属性,那就是互动性。学生不是被动地看直播,他们需要随时提问、回答问题、参与讨论。一个好的在线教育平台,老师应该能够看到每个学生的学习状态,学生也应该能够随时举手发言。这种高频双向互动,对延迟的要求是极其苛刻的。
我们来做个对比你就明白了。如果你看一场普通的直播演唱会,画面延迟个几秒钟,你可能根本感受不到。但在线教育课堂上,如果老师提问后要等两三秒才能听到学生的回答,那种体验是非常糟糕的。更别说有些教学场景需要实时演示、即时反馈,延迟一高,整个教学效果就会大打折扣。
除了延迟之外,稳定性也是关键考量因素。一堂45分钟的课程,如果中间出现卡顿、花屏或者断线,不仅影响学习效果,更会严重影响用户体验。在教育这个场景下,用户对质量的容忍度是相对较低的,毕竟大家是来学习的,不是来凑合的。
选云服务器配置,最该关注这几个核心指标

延迟:在线教育的生命线
前面我已经强调了延迟的重要性,这里再展开说说。在线教育场景中,我们通常建议端到端延迟控制在200毫秒以内,理想状态是能够达到100毫秒以下。这个数字看起来不大,但真正实现起来并不容易。
影响延迟的因素有很多,网络传输路径、服务器处理能力、数据编解码效率都会产生直接影响。很多云服务商宣称的"低延迟",在实际教育场景中可能根本无法满足需求。这也是为什么很多在线教育平台在选择技术服务时,会特别关注服务商在实时音视频领域的积累和沉淀。
带宽:看不见的隐形成本
带宽这个问题,看起来简单,但实际配置的时候很容易让人懵圈。带宽小了,视频不清晰、卡顿;带宽大了,成本又上去了。找到那个最优平衡点,是一件需要仔细权衡的事情。
在线教育的带宽消耗主要来自三个方面:老师端的视频上行、学生端的视频下行、以及课件数据的传输。不同的教学模式,带宽需求差异也很大。一对一的口语陪练课,跟几百人的大班直播课,对带宽的要求完全不在一个量级。
这里有个小技巧建议给大家,在规划带宽的时候,不要仅仅考虑峰值需求,还要考虑波峰波谷的差异。很多在线教育平台的上课时间是相对集中的(比如晚上7点到9点),这种潮汐式的流量特征,意味着你可能需要在峰值时段准备足够的带宽资源,但其他时间这些资源就闲置了。如何在成本和体验之间取得平衡,需要结合自身的业务特点来具体分析。
并发能力:决定你能同时服务多少学生
并发能力听起来是个技术术语,但其实很好理解——就是你的服务器能同时支持多少学生在线上课。这个指标直接关系到你的业务天花板。

举个具体的例子。如果你的平台同时有1000个学生在线,每个学生需要1Mbps的带宽下载视频流,那你的总带宽需求就是1000Mbps。如果你有10个这样的班级同时开课,那就是10000Mbps也就是10Gbps的带宽需求。这还只是视频流的部分,加上音频、消息、互动数据,实际需求会更高。
并发能力的另一个维度是即时通讯。在线教育课堂上,学生提问、老师回答、弹幕互动,这些实时消息的并发量可能比视频本身还要惊人。一个热闹的课堂,一分钟内可能有几百甚至上千条消息往来,这对服务器的消息推送能力是很大的考验。
扩展性:为未来增长预留空间
很多人在选择云服务器配置的时候,容易犯的一个错误就是只考虑当下的需求。教育市场的变化是很快的,今天你可能只有几百个用户,明天可能就扩展到几万甚至几十万。如果服务器架构没有预留足够的扩展空间,到时候重新迁移、扩容的成本会非常高。
我建议在初始规划时,至少要预留3到5倍的扩展空间。也就是说,如果你现在预计峰值用户是1000人,那服务器架构应该能够轻松支持3000到5000人的并发。这不是让你现在就用这么大的配置,而是要让系统具备弹性扩容的能力,在业务增长的时候能够平滑过渡。
不同教育场景的配置差异
在线教育不是一个铁板一块的领域,不同的教学场景对服务器配置的要求差异很大。如果你用管理大班课的配置去做一对一辅导,那成本会高得吓人;反过来,如果用一对一的配置去支撑大班课,体验又会一塌糊涂。下面我来具体说说几种常见场景的配置要点。
一对一辅导与口语陪练
一对一场景是所有在线教育模式中对即时性要求最高的。因为整个课堂只有两个参与者,任何延迟、卡顿都会显得格外明显。在这个场景下,我们追求的是极致的通话质量,延迟最好控制在200毫秒以内,画质也要能够支持高清视频通话。
这种场景的服务器配置相对简单,因为它不涉及大量的并发连接问题。核心是要选择在全球范围内都有节点覆盖的服务商,确保师生双方无论在哪里,都能够就近接入,获得最佳的通话质量。特别是对于口语陪练这种高频互动的场景,网络覆盖的广度和深度直接决定了用户体验的上限。
小班课与互动教学
小班课通常指的是一个老师带几个到十几个学生的课堂。这种场景的复杂度在于,既要保证每个学生的视频都能被老师看到(上行),又要让每个学生都能看到老师和同学的画面(下行)。
在小班课场景中,视频布局的灵活性是很重要的技术需求。有时候需要显示老师的全屏画面,有时候需要把学生的画面并排显示,有时候又需要切换焦点。这种动态的画面布局,对服务器的视频合成和转码能力提出了较高要求。
此外,小班课通常会有更多的互动环节,比如分组讨论、协作白板、实时问答等。这些功能都需要服务器具备强大的消息通道和状态同步能力,确保所有参与者的操作都能实时呈现在每个人的界面上。
大班直播课与公开课
大班直播课是很多教育机构常用的模式,一个老师面对几十甚至几百个学生。这种场景的特点是,学生主要是接收信息,互动相对较少,但观看体验必须稳定流畅。
在大班课场景中,CDN分发是关键。好的CDN网络能够确保全国各地的学生都能流畅观看,而不会因为网络传输距离远而出现卡顿。同时,服务器需要具备足够的下行带宽能力,支持大规模的并发访问。
这里有个值得注意的点。大班课虽然对即时互动的要求不如小班课高,但在答疑环节可能会面临瞬时的高并发消息涌入。比如老师抛出一个问题,几十个学生同时回答,这种瞬时的消息峰值需要服务器有足够的处理能力来消化。
技术架构选型的实战建议
说完这些核心指标和场景差异,我想分享一些实操层面的建议。这些经验来自于行业内的观察和实践,希望能够帮大家少走一些弯路。
首先,关于自建服务器和采购云服务的选择。我的建议是,对于绝大多数在线教育平台来说,采购专业的实时音视频云服务是更明智的选择。自建服务器听起来省钱,但实际上需要投入大量的人力物力去维护和优化,而且很难达到专业云服务的质量水平。特别是在实时音视频这个技术壁垒很高的领域,专业的事情交给专业的人来做,往往效果更好、成本更低。
其次,在选择云服务提供商的时候,一定要关注其在教育领域的积累。教育场景的特殊性在于,它对稳定性、互动性、质量的要求比一般的娱乐直播场景更高。没有在这个领域深耕过的服务商,很难真正理解这些需求并提供针对性的解决方案。
以行业内领先的实时音视频服务商为例,像声网这样的专业平台,在教育领域有多年的深耕经验。他们能够针对不同规模、不同类型的教育场景提供定制化的解决方案,从底层网络架构到上层应用功能,都做了大量的优化和适配。这种行业积累带来的技术优势,不是随便找个云服务商就能替代的。
最后,技术架构的选型一定要跟业务发展规划相匹配。如果你正处于快速增长的阶段,那就要选择具备弹性扩容能力的服务商;如果你准备开拓海外市场,那就要考虑服务商的全球节点覆盖情况;如果你有一些特殊的功能需求,比如AI智能伴学、实时翻译等,那就要评估服务商在这些方面的技术能力。
写在最后
回顾整个云服务器配置的选择过程,我最大的感触是:没有放之四海而皆准的最优方案,只有最适合你当前业务阶段的合理方案。
在线教育这个领域,技术是基础,但不是全部。服务器配置再豪华,如果没有好的教学内容和用户体验,也很难留住用户。反过来说,如果技术底座不扎实,再好的教学内容也无法有效传递给学员。这是一个需要平衡的艺术。
我的建议是,在初期可以把更多的精力放在验证业务模式上,选择成熟稳定的云服务方案,避免在技术细节上过度纠缠。当业务跑通、用户量上来之后,再根据实际情况进行深度优化和定制。这种渐进式的技术投入策略,对于大多数教育创业团队来说都是更加稳妥的选择。
教育是一个需要长期投入的事业,技术选型同样需要用长期主义的视角来看待。希望这篇文章能够给正在搭建在线教育平台的朋友们一些参考。如果有什么问题,也欢迎在实践中继续探讨。

